Transaction 58b05589c2fe7d958ef4fddfa70795b0afc217f6a3f4a80eab25f8e209f2109e
1 Input
1 Output
-
58b05589c2fe7d958ef4fddfa70795b0afc217f6a3f4a80eab25f8e209f2109e:0
- value
- 847423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7519364252fd474c9b88084944873aad29a96760 OP_EQUAL
- address
- 3CNBBkA1yfRUmYBJHNwCwGggUUtZaRg8SP